Output c83c30da42ff8ef84ca586451f4e0a38db7e236c407b245dee5aa05855428de6:5

value
342804153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 395f610c4f8abb94a33bdf28ad5b60b2ee89a2e6 OP_EQUALVERIFY OP_CHECKSIG
address
16EMmzRGPKqBDnLEXJkQa3AQ5SbsgbVqJ4
transaction
c83c30da42ff8ef84ca586451f4e0a38db7e236c407b245dee5aa05855428de6
spent
true